Researchers from Stanford University and the University of Waterloo, Canada, analyzed data from prize winners from 1950 to 2009. The results were compared with data from winners of the Lasker Award, which is another prestigious award in the field of medicine. The scientists compared the two awards to confirm that age does not significantly impact performance after receiving the awards. Nobel Prize winners are usually awarded later in their careers when less work would be expected. https://www.sciencealert.com/winning-the-nobel-prize-may-bestow-an-unfortunate-side-effect

As the Earth's temperature continues to rise, virologist Jean-Michel Claverie's research reveals the emergence of ancient viruses, some dating back nearly 50,000 years, from thawing Siberian permafrost. These dormant pathogens, awakened by climate change, pose a potential threat to public health as they resurface. Claverie's findings highlight the need for vigilance and further research to understand and mitigate the risks associated with these ancient viruses, which could have disastrous effects if they infect humans or other organisms. https://economictimes.indiatimes.com/news/new-updates/zombie-viruses-may-awaken-by-2030-after-50000-years-of-dormancy-due-to-global-warming-research/articleshow/104339783.cms

The 2023 Nobel Prize in Physiology or Medicine has been awarded to Katalin Karikó and Drew Weissman for their discoveries concerning nucleoside base modifications that enabled the development of effective mRNA vaccines against COVID-19. Through their groundbreaking findings, which have fundamentally changed our understanding of how mRNA interacts with our immune system, the laureates contributed to the unprecedented rate of vaccine development during one of the greatest threats to human health in modern times. https://www.nobelprize.org/prizes/medicine/2023/advanced-information/

NASA will tug its space station out of orbit and crash it into the Pacific Ocean. The retirement plan is set for 2031, with the first stages beginning in 2026. The International Space Station is entering its third and most productive decade as a groundbreaking scientific platform in microgravity. https://www.dailymail.co.uk/sciencetech/article-12562389/NASA-announces-plan-tug-ISS-Earth-spaceship.html
